Lines Matching refs:hwc
26 Hwcomposer *hwc = static_cast<Hwcomposer*>(dev); \
28 if (!hwc) { \
47 if (!hwc->prepare(numDisplays, displays)) { in hwc_prepare()
59 if (!hwc->commit(numDisplays, displays)) { in hwc_set()
71 hwc->dump(buff, buff_len, 0); in hwc_dump()
78 hwc->registerProcs(procs); in hwc_registerProcs()
106 ret = hwc->vsyncControl(disp, enabled); in hwc_eventControl()
123 bool ret = hwc->blank(disp, blank); in hwc_blank()
138 bool ret = hwc->getDisplayConfigs(disp, configs, numConfigs); in hwc_getDisplayConfigs()
154 bool ret = hwc->getDisplayAttributes(disp, config, attributes, values); in hwc_getDisplayAttributes()
166 bool ret = hwc->compositionComplete(disp); in hwc_compositionComplete()
178 bool ret = hwc->setPowerMode(disp, mode); in hwc_setPowerMode()
190 int ret = hwc->getActiveConfig(disp); in hwc_getActiveConfig()
202 bool ret = hwc->setActiveConfig(disp, index); in hwc_setActiveConfig()
214 bool ret = hwc->setCursorPositionAsync(disp, x, y); in hwc_setCursorPositionAsync()
241 Hwcomposer& hwc = Hwcomposer::getInstance(); in hwc_device_open() local
243 if (hwc.initialize() == false) { in hwc_device_open()
250 hwc.hwc_composer_device_1_t::common.tag = HARDWARE_DEVICE_TAG; in hwc_device_open()
251 hwc.hwc_composer_device_1_t::common.module = in hwc_device_open()
253 hwc.hwc_composer_device_1_t::common.close = hwc_device_close; in hwc_device_open()
255 hwc.hwc_composer_device_1_t::prepare = hwc_prepare; in hwc_device_open()
256 hwc.hwc_composer_device_1_t::set = hwc_set; in hwc_device_open()
257 hwc.hwc_composer_device_1_t::dump = hwc_dump; in hwc_device_open()
258 hwc.hwc_composer_device_1_t::registerProcs = hwc_registerProcs; in hwc_device_open()
259 hwc.hwc_composer_device_1_t::query = hwc_query; in hwc_device_open()
261 hwc.hwc_composer_device_1_t::blank = hwc_blank; in hwc_device_open()
262 hwc.hwc_composer_device_1_t::eventControl = hwc_eventControl; in hwc_device_open()
263 hwc.hwc_composer_device_1_t::getDisplayConfigs = hwc_getDisplayConfigs; in hwc_device_open()
264 hwc.hwc_composer_device_1_t::getDisplayAttributes = hwc_getDisplayAttributes; in hwc_device_open()
267 hwc.hwc_composer_device_1_t::reserved_proc[0] = (void*)hwc_compositionComplete; in hwc_device_open()
268 hwc.hwc_composer_device_1_t::common.version = HWC_DEVICE_API_VERSION_1_4; in hwc_device_open()
269 hwc.hwc_composer_device_1_t::setPowerMode = hwc_setPowerMode; in hwc_device_open()
270 hwc.hwc_composer_device_1_t::getActiveConfig = hwc_getActiveConfig; in hwc_device_open()
271 hwc.hwc_composer_device_1_t::setActiveConfig = hwc_setActiveConfig; in hwc_device_open()
273 hwc.hwc_composer_device_1_t::setCursorPositionAsync = NULL; in hwc_device_open()
275 *device = &hwc.hwc_composer_device_1_t::common; in hwc_device_open()